Aldehydes are prepared by reacting a mixture of an olefine gas or vapour, carbon monoxide and hydrogen in the presence of a cobalt oxo catalyst soluble in the products. The concentration of the olefine in the mixture to be reacted is from 5 to 20% by volume, and ethyene, if present in the mixture containing an olefine with 3 or 4 C atoms, is in an amount less than 5%, and the temperature of the reaction is at least 75 DEG C., and the pressure of the mixture at least 40 atmospheres. The process is preferably continuous and cobalt oxide on kieselguhr or silica gel is the preferred catalyst. Examples describe the reaction of propylene to form butyraldehyde; of a mixture of propylene and ethylene to form propionaldehyde and n- and is obutyraldehyde; and of ethylene, propylene and butene-1 to form propionaldehyde, n- and iso - butyraldehyde, n - valeraldehyde and 2 - methylbutyraldehyde. |
